Using narrative case studies drawn from Star Trek to illustrate core concepts, The Enterprise of Work offers an engaging and innovative textbook that demonstrates how psychology can be applied to the workplace. For over six decades, Star Trek has offered one of the most enduring cultural explorations of leadership, teamwork, ethics, and institutional design. The franchise presents organizations as systems structured around purpose, cooperation, and collective responsibility, making it an ideal analytical framework for understanding Industrial-Organizational Psychology and Organizational Behaviour. Each chapter is built around a fully developed narrative case that requires students to diagnose workplace problems, apply theory to ambiguous situations, and justify decisions using evidence. It allows students to engage with recurring characters, roles, and organizational structures across multiple scenarios, and treats concepts as embedded within evolving organizational contexts to show how leadership decisions, team dynamics, and psychological processes unfold over time. Engaging and pedagogically rich, this is the ideal textbook for undergraduate and graduate-level Industrial-Organizational Psychology and Organizational Behaviour courses.
